Let's talk a little bit about adding people to your house deed oftentimes people try to avoid probate and pass their real property on to say their children or someone else by adding the person to their deed as a joint tenant with right of survivorship when you add somebody to your deed or when somebody's on your deed with
You as a joint tenant with right of survivorship it means that if you die they own the property outright the moment you're dead if they die you own the property outright the moment they pass so it's a very convenient way to pass property but the problem with it is that if you pass property this way and the
